Can I Use Two Starlinks at Once for My Business? Yes, with Speedify

Speedify Lets Your Business Use Two Starlinks at Once for Faster Upload and Download Speeds and a More Reliable and Secure Internet Connection

Your business can use two Starlink connections at once. Each Starlink dish is a separate internet connection. Speedify bonds both simultaneously using Speedify’s channel bonding technology, so both dishes carry your business traffic at the same time. You get faster upload and download speeds from their combined capacity, automatic failover if either connection drops, and a more resilient internet setup for your business operations.

This guide covers when two Starlink connections make sense for a business, what Speedify adds, and how to get both running together.

Quick answer

Should you get a backup connection for Starlink?

Yes. Starlink goes down every day — an always-on dish averages about 34 minutes of downtime daily from routine satellite handoffs. A second connection keeps you online when Starlink drops.

What’s the best backup connection for Starlink?

A 4G/5G cellular hotspot or SIM is the most practical backup for most Starlink users — it works anywhere Starlink works, requires no installation, and uses a different network so outages rarely overlap. Cable or DSL broadband is a strong option if you have it at a fixed location. A second Starlink dish is also possible if you need maximum throughput.

When Two Starlinks Make Sense for a Business

A single Starlink internet connection is often enough for small teams in remote locations with low to moderate internet demand. But as team size grows, or as operations become more dependent on continuous internet access, a single satellite connection becomes a single point of failure.

Businesses that run on Starlink face a specific risk: one bad weather event, one dish obstruction, or one period of heavy satellite congestion can take the whole operation offline. For businesses where internet downtime means lost revenue, missed communications, or failed transactions, that risk is unacceptable.

Two Starlinks solve this. One dish continues operating while the other is affected. With Speedify bonding both, your business also gets the combined upload and download capacity of both dishes during normal operation, not just failover protection.

For the strongest redundancy, two dishes on separate Starlink accounts draw from different satellite infrastructure pools and are less likely to be throttled simultaneously.

How Speedify Manages Two Starlink Internet Connections for Business

Speedify monitors both Starlink connections continuously, measuring latency, packet loss, and available bandwidth on each. When both connections are healthy, Speedify distributes traffic across both and delivers up to 95% of their combined upload and download capacity. When one connection degrades or drops, Speedify shifts all traffic to the working dish at the packet level. Active VoIP calls, video conferences, file transfers, and cloud application sessions are not interrupted.

Speedify also encrypts all business internet traffic across both Starlink connections, protecting sensitive data on every path.

How to Use Two Starlinks at Once for Your Business with Speedify

Step 1: Set Up Both Starlink Dishes

Install and activate both Starlink dishes. Each dish needs its own router. For maximum redundancy, use separate Starlink accounts for each dish. Confirm both Starlinks are delivering active internet connections.

Step 2: Connect Your Devices or Business Router to Both Starlink Networks

Connect your business router or primary device to the first Starlink router via Ethernet. Connect to the second Starlink router via a second Ethernet port or a USB network adapter. Confirm both connections appear as separate active interfaces.

Step 3: Download and Run Speedify

Download Speedify and install it on your device or business router. Speedify will detect both Starlink connections and begin bonding them immediately. No manual routing configuration is required.

Speedify manages both connections in the background from that point, combining them for faster upload and download speeds, monitoring both paths, failing over instantly, and encrypting all traffic.

Speedify Also Monitors Both Starlink Dishes for Your Business

Speedify displays real-time Starlink dish alerts for each connected dish in the app dashboard. If either dish detects a stuck actuator motor, a non-vertical mast, or a thermal throttle condition, Speedify surfaces the alert immediately. Alerts appear when the condition has been active for at least 15 seconds and clear once resolved.

For IT managers overseeing business Starlink deployments, Speedify provides hardware visibility across both dishes from the same dashboard managing your connections.
